Bill has more than 30 years of financial services experience. He focuses on long-term financial issues that clients face including investments, estate planning, insurance, and asset allocation. He works with all types of individual investors as well as small business owners. Bill believes it is imperative to outline ones' goals and objectives, implement a plan to pursue these goals, and, more importantly, to periodically review the progress related to these goals and make adjustments as needed. Bill is a CERTIFIED FINANCIAL PLANNER™ with an MBA in Finance from Rutgers University.
